The Science of Basic Crystal Colorants

Understanding the chemical properties, ionic bonds, and physical morphology of advanced crystal dye matrices.

Basic dyes, often categorized as cationic colorants, represent a group of synthetic organic compounds that dissociate in aqueous solutions to yield positively charged color ions. The chromophore of a basic dye carries a net positive charge, which exhibits a remarkable electrostatic affinity for anionic (negatively charged) substrates. This chemical dynamic makes basic dyes exceptionally powerful for coloring acrylic fibers, modified polyesters, polyacrylonitriles, lignocellulosic fibers, paper pulps, and natural proteins like wool, silk, and finished leathers.
In the global marketplace, Basic Crystal formulations are highly preferred over traditional fine powder formats. Historically, fine powder dyes posed a significant airborne hazard in weighing rooms and mixing departments. The dust generated during manipulation could settle on surrounding surfaces, leading to secondary contamination, and presented serious respiratory risks to operators.
By crystallizing the dye molecules—such as in the manufacturing of Nigrosine Black Crystals or high-purity Auramine O Conc—producers achieve several physical advantages:

Dust-Free Workplace

The dense crystalline lattice prevents the fragmentation of particles into respirable dust, ensuring a clean, safe preparation room and zero dry-particle migration.

Rapid & Complete Solubility

Crystalline molecules are structured to facilitate rapid hydration, allowing them to dissolve quickly and completely in hot water without clumping or leaving undissolved micro-aggregates.

Enhanced Storage Stability

With a lower surface-area-to-volume ratio than ultra-fine powders, crystal forms exhibit superior resistance to atmospheric moisture absorption, preventing compaction and caking during transport.

Environmental Stewardship & Global Compliance

In the contemporary chemical industry, ecological accountability is the foundational pillar of innovation. Modern supply networks demand comprehensive tracking of chemical inputs to ensure that end-use textiles, papers, and plastics present zero risks to consumers and the environment.天津升瑞化工 (Tianjin Sunrise Chem Group) has invested heavily in modern chemical tracking and ecological purification technologies to achieve compliance at all manufacturing stages.

Our primary operational facilities hold the prestigious ZDHC Level 3 certification. This is the highest tier of conformance defined under the Zero Discharge of Hazardous Chemicals Roadmap to Zero Programme. It signifies that our product formulations undergo intensive third-party testing and audit protocols, guaranteeing that restricted chemical substances (MRSL) are entirely absent from our chemical processing streams.

Furthermore, our Global Organic Textile Standard (GOTS) certification ensures that our dyes can be utilized with complete confidence in organic fabric supply lines. This certification process validates our commitment to minimizing ecological footprints, ensuring fair labor standards, and optimizing resource efficiency. By using our certified colorants, mills can access restrictive consumer markets in the European Union, North America, and beyond without additional chemical clearance hurdles.

Technical Q&A: Understanding Crystal Dye Chemistry

Expert technical answers to common questions regarding storage, application, and compliance of basic crystal dyes.

Q1: What defines a "Basic Crystal" dye, and how does it compare to acid or direct dyes?
A basic dye is a cationic colorant where the coloring agent exists as a positively charged ion (cation) in solution. These dyes possess outstanding bonding capabilities with anionic (negatively charged) substrates like acrylics, polyacrylonitrile, and lignin-rich paper pulp. In contrast, acid and direct dyes are anionic (negatively charged) in solution and are primarily utilized to dye wool, silk, nylon, or cellulosic cotton. The "Crystal" suffix refers to the physical morphology of the dye, which has been processed into crystalline plates or grains to minimize dust generation and improve solubility.

Q4: Are crystalline dyes less soluble than fine powder dyes?
No. In fact, our crystal dyes are engineered to dissolve more easily than powders. Fine powder dyes often clump together when added to water, creating dry pockets that require aggressive stirring and hot water to break down. Our crystalline structures hydrate quickly, breaking down and dissolving uniformly without clumping or generating dust.
Q5: What are the ideal storage parameters to prevent crystal dyes from caking?
Although crystal dyes resist moisture absorption better than powders, they should still be stored in cool, dry, well-ventilated warehouses. Keep containers sealed tightly when not in use. Avoid direct sunlight and high heat, which can soften some organic dyes. Stacking pallets should follow height safety guidelines to prevent compression caking over time.
